Fig. 4: Identification and confirmation of intronic insertion variant, likely derived from an SVA retrotransposable element, in the last intron of MECP2.
From: Integrated multi-omics for rapid rare disease diagnosis on a national scale

a, Integrated Genomics Viewer (IGV) proband RNA (top) and DNA (bottom) short-read sequencing data indicating the presence of a DNA insertion resulting in the inclusion of a pseudo-exon in the last intron of MECP2. b, Nanopore sequencing data demonstrating the insertion. c, PCR gel electrophoresis of relevant MECP2 region in the proband (A0131084), parents (A0131084-M and A0131084-P) and a control sample (NA12878), consistent with an insertion of approximately 2.6 kb. This clinically accredited assay was performed once. d, Schematic of the observed splicing outcomes of MECP2 in the proband with the presence of a transposon-derived pseudo-exon, residual canonical splicing, skipping of the penultimate exon and intronic read-through. WT, wild-type.
